The troubles Boston homes give an electric repair

Older areas like Dorchester, Roslindale, and East Boston are full of residences that inform an electrical expert precisely when they were developed the moment the panel door swings open. I have actually opened up plenty that still had actually cloth-insulated circuitry, short-run branch circuits, or an overloaded subpanel offering a basement apartment added years later. The signs and symptoms differ. Lights lightening up when the refrigerator cycles. GFCIs that trip on damp days yet act in winter season. Two-prong receptacles in living rooms with a rat's nest of adapters. Each of these narrates about the home's bones.

Boston's seaside air increases deterioration, particularly anywhere the service decrease hardware or meter socket is revealed. I once responded to repeated breaker trips in a South Boston triple-decker where the concern turned out to be moisture breach via hairline splits in the solution head. Salt plus condensation chewed the neutral lug. The solution wasn't glamorous: replace the pole, weatherhead, and lugs, reseal, and confirm bonding and grounding at the water solution. The payoff was instant, and the nuisance journeys vanished.

Modern enhancements add their own problems. Heatpump, induction arrays, tankless hot water heater, office that in fact run like tiny web server areas, Degree 2 EV battery chargers in limited back-alley auto parking. Each new tons stresses panels that were never ever sized for today's needs. Leading electrician repair service Boston groups prosper at integrating those new assumptions with an older framework, without removing what still has useful life.

Safety first, speed second

There's a time for quick solutions. There's additionally a time to reduce. If you scent shedding near an outlet, really feel warmth at a button plate, or notice arcing appears at a panel, power down that circuit and call an accredited pro. Same advice for flickering lights come with by a sizzling noise or a breaker that trips immediately with nothing plugged in. These are indications of loosened conductors, falling short breakers, or jeopardized insulation, and continued usage threats a fire.

I get asked about DIY all the time. Exchanging a lighting fixture can be uncomplicated, gave package is ranked for the fixture's weight and you know just how to safeguard the equipment grounding conductor. The lines blur when you enter multiwire branch circuits, shared neutrals, or boxes crowded past ability. Boston's brownstones typically have extremely superficial stonework boxes; pressing in a modern-day smart dimmer without dealing with quantity and heat dissipation can cause persistent failures. When doubtful, consult, not guess.

What to anticipate from a proper electric diagnosis

A great medical diagnosis starts with listening. A property owner that claims, "The room lights lower when the home window air conditioning kicks on," has actually offered you a hint concerning voltage decrease and possibly a shared circuit at its restriction. After that, we evaluate. A reputable service technician will certainly gauge voltage at the panel and at end-of-line receptacles, check breaker torque, check for double-lugged neutrals, and try to find warm signatures with a thermal electronic camera when appropriate. In older homes, we examine GFCIs and AFCIs under tons, not just with the onboard switch, because hassle journeys can conceal bad connections or shared neutrals that require reconfiguration.

Permitting belongs to the work for anything past like-for-like swaps. That consists of panel replacements, brand-new circuits, and major fixings to service equipment. In Boston, licenses are submitted with the Inspectional Services Department. Common Boston electrical fixings that pay off

Panel upgrades still deliver worth. Several homes bring 60 or 100 amps of solution, which worked fine when the largest draw was a central heating boiler and a couple of home appliances. Add an EV charger, mini-splits for air conditioning, and an induction cooktop, and you'll appreciate 150 to 200 amps. Upgrading is not only concerning the major breaker. It's a possibility to clean up neutrals and grounds, tag circuits, add rise defense, and plan for future loads.

Grounding and bonding enhancements quietly fix numerous gremlins. I have seen intermittent shocks at a kitchen area sink removed by bonding a new copper water service appropriately to the panel and validating the extra ground poles. In an additional case, computer systems randomly rebooted throughout tornados till we added a whole-home rise safety gadget and tightened a loose neutral bar.

Aluminum branch circuits from the 60s and 70s appear periodically. They can be risk-free when treated properly, but the connection points are vulnerable. Copalum kinking or AlumiConn connectors, mounted by qualified specialists, reduce danger without gutting wall surfaces. Pigtailing with ordinary wire nuts is not acceptable.

Knob-and-tube appears in pockets, sometimes hidden behind later remodellings. By code, you can not hide energetic knob-and-tube under insulation. If you're insulating an attic in Jamaica Plain, strategy to replace those runs or isolate them before the cellulose arrives. Smart sequencing between electrician and insulation professional conserves money.

Weather, salt, and the situation for proactive maintenance

Boston tosses salt spray, wind, ice, and sticky summertime humidity at anything installed outside. Service heads fracture, meter outlets oxidize, channel seals loosen. A once-a-year aesthetic check catches damage prior to it cascades. A lot of reputable electrician Boston groups supply maintenance plans that include tightening up panel discontinuations, screening GFCI/AFCI devices, verifying ground resistance, and examining load distribution.

I advise focusing on outdoor electrical outlets and fixtures, especially on coastal-facing wall surfaces. Swap worn gaskets, use in-use covers for receptacles, and pick components with marine-grade finishes when you are within a mile or 2 of the harbor. On decks and roof covering outdoor patios, make certain boxes are wet-location rated and effectively supported; I still locate fixtures hung from old pancake boxes on exterior soffits where a much deeper, gasketed box must have been used.

The wise home wrinkle

Boston homes have actually accepted wise thermostats, dimmers, and whole-house systems. These incorporate magnificently when set up with attention to basics. Neutral schedule at switch locations is the first obstacle. Many older switch loops do not have neutrals in package; requiring wise tools right into these boxes produces flicker, ghosting, or gadget failing. A thoughtful electrician will certainly run a neutral where needed or specify gadgets created for two-wire settings that still fulfill code.

Radio frequency blockage is likewise genuine in dense communities. A financial institution of apartments with overlapping Wi-Fi and Zigbee or Z-Wave networks can make tools behave unpredictably. Experienced installers position repeaters very carefully, section networks, and choose products with trustworthy regional control so you are not stuck when the internet hiccups.

Energy and electrification, Boston-style

Electrification isn't just a buzzword when your gas infrastructure is maturing and your old vapor boiler groans with February. Heatpump, induction cooking, and heatpump hot water heater are now typical around the city. These upgrades regularly set off panel evaluations, and occasionally service upgrades. A great electrical expert walks through tons computations utilizing sensible responsibility cycles as opposed to worst-case piling of every appliance simultaneously. Smart panels or tons administration tools can avoid a costly solution upgrade when the home's envelope and way of life allow it. For instance, a load-shedding gadget can momentarily stop EV charging when the stove and clothes dryer remain in use, remaining within a 100-amp solution's capacity.

Solar adds one more layer. Interconnection in Boston is mature, but you still require clear labeling, proper rapid closure devices, and updated grounding and bonding at the solution. If you intend to include battery storage later, ask your electrical expert to pre-wire avenue between panel and prospective battery place. Small choices like avenue sizing and path conserve hours down the line.

Tenant buildings and condominium specifics

Triple-deckers and condominium conversions present common infrastructure. I've moderated more than one argument over a flickering corridor light that linked back to a neutral shared improperly in between units. Clean separation of meters, panels, and neutrals prevents conflicts and fire risks. Alike areas, use tamper-resistant, self-testing GFCI outlets, and plainly tag which panel feeds what. For condominium organizations, established a yearly budget for electrical upkeep, just like roof, because deferred electric issues ultimately end up being emergency calls at the worst time.

Rental systems require tamper-resistant receptacles and smoke and carbon monoxide detection that meets present code. Exchanging ran out 9-volt detectors for hardwired, interconnected units with battery backup is a straightforward retrofit that substantially improves security. Deal with an electrical contractor who recognizes examination needs for rental certifications and can supply the essential documentation.

Small repairs that make a big difference

Not every call is a panel adjustment. Many of the most effective lasting renovations are modest.

Replacing old two-prong receptacles with correctly grounded, three-prong receptacles removes the daisy chain of adapters and harmful bootleg grounds that emerge in older systems. Where grounding isn't present and rewiring is not instantly feasible, a GFCI receptacle labeled "No Tools Ground" is a defensible interim remedy, though not a substitute for a real ground when delicate electronic devices are involved.

Installing tamper-resistant electrical outlets throughout homes with youngsters protects against the spying of interested fingers or barrettes. It's economical and needed by code forever reason.

Adding whole-home rise defense guards home appliances and electronics versus spikes, especially in communities with frequent failures. A single gadget at the panel, incorporated with high quality point-of-use guards for delicate equipment, uses layered protection.

Kitchen and bathroom upgrades are frequently just adding the ideal circuits, not removing coatings. Devoted circuits for microwaves, dishwashers, and disposals keep hassle journeys at bay. In older galley kitchens common to many Boston apartments, careful positioning and checking of tiny device circuits avoids overloading the one counter outlet everybody utilizes for toaster ovens and coffee machines.

Frequently Asked Questions About Electrical Repair in Boston


What do local electricians charge per hour?

Local electricians typically charge between $75 and $150 per hour. Rates vary by experience, license level, and job complexity. Emergency or after-hours work often costs more.

How much do electricians make in Boston MA?

Electricians in Boston typically earn between $70,000 and $100,000 per year. Union electricians and those with specialized skills often earn more. Overtime and prevailing wage projects can significantly increase earnings.

Are electricians in demand in Massachusetts?

Yes, electricians are in strong demand in Massachusetts. Ongoing construction, infrastructure upgrades, and renewable energy projects drive demand. Retirements in the skilled trades also contribute to labor shortages.

What is the typical minimum charge for electricians?

The typical minimum charge ranges from $100 to $200 for a service call. This usually covers the first hour of labor. Diagnostic work is often included in this minimum fee.

How much is electricity in Boston?

Electricity in Boston typically costs about $0.29 to $0.35 per kilowatt-hour. Rates fluctuate based on supply costs, transmission fees, and seasonal demand. Massachusetts consistently ranks among the highest-cost states for electricity.

What is the minimum pay for an electrician?

Entry-level electricians typically earn $20 to $25 per hour. Apprentices often start lower while completing required training hours. Pay increases with licensing and experience.

How much for an electrician to check wiring?

A wiring inspection typically costs between $100 and $250. The price depends on the time required and whether troubleshooting is involved. More complex diagnostics can increase the cost.

How do electricians calculate prices?

Electricians calculate prices based on hourly labor, materials, and job complexity. Some projects are priced as flat rates for predictable tasks. Travel time, permits, and overhead are also factored in.

Why is Boston electricity so expensive?

Boston electricity is expensive due to high transmission costs and limited local energy production. Natural gas supply constraints in New England raise wholesale prices. Regulatory and infrastructure costs further increase consumer rates.

How much does it cost to rewire a house in Massachusetts?

Rewiring a house in Massachusetts typically costs $8,000 to $20,000. Price depends on home size, accessibility, and panel upgrades. Older homes often cost more due to code compliance requirements.

How much should an electrician charge for 8 hours?

For eight hours of work, electricians typically charge $600 to $1,200. The total depends on the hourly rate and job type. Materials and permit fees are usually billed separately.
